Action Performed:

Precondition:

  • Workspace has per diem rates.
  • At least one subrate has negative amount.
  1. Go to staging.new.expensify.com
  2. Go to workspace chat.
  3. Submit two same per diem rates with a negative amount.
  4. Go to transaction thread of any expense in Step 3.
  5. Click Review duplicates.
  6. Click Keep this one on any expense preview.
  7. Click Confirm.

Expected Result:

The negative amount will be preserved.

Actual Result:

The negative amount turns to positive amount after sorting duplicates.
